comparison core/src/luan/impl/TableExpr.java @ 645:859c0dedc8b6

remove LuanSource
author Franklin Schmidt <fschmidt@gmail.com>
date Tue, 29 Mar 2016 18:09:51 -0600
parents b48cfa14ba60
children
comparison
equal deleted inserted replaced
644:ba1e318377c5 645:859c0dedc8b6
1 package luan.impl; 1 package luan.impl;
2 2
3 import luan.LuanException; 3 import luan.LuanException;
4 import luan.LuanTable; 4 import luan.LuanTable;
5 import luan.LuanElement;
6 import luan.Luan; 5 import luan.Luan;
7 6
8 7
9 final class TableExpr extends CodeImpl implements Expr { 8 final class TableExpr extends CodeImpl implements Expr {
10 9
19 } 18 }
20 19
21 private final Field[] fields; 20 private final Field[] fields;
22 private final Expressions expressions; 21 private final Expressions expressions;
23 22
24 TableExpr(LuanElement se,Field[] fields,Expressions expressions) { 23 TableExpr(Field[] fields,Expressions expressions) {
25 super(se);
26 this.fields = fields; 24 this.fields = fields;
27 this.expressions = expressions; 25 this.expressions = expressions;
28 } 26 }
29 27
30 @Override public Object eval(LuanStateImpl luan) throws LuanException { 28 @Override public Object eval(LuanStateImpl luan) throws LuanException {